Understanding the Altcoin Market Recovery

The altcoin market recovery has been gradually building strength. After a period of sideways movement, many altcoins have started gaining value again, supported by increased trading activity and improved sentiment.

One major reason behind this recovery is the stability of larger cryptocurrencies. When Bitcoin and Ethereum maintain steady prices, investors often shift their focus toward altcoins in search of higher returns. This shift creates momentum across the market and allows smaller assets to grow faster.

Another key factor is the return of investor confidence. Many traders who stayed away during uncertain times are now coming back, encouraged by positive trends and increased adoption of blockchain technology. This renewed interest is playing a major role in driving the crypto market recovery forward.

Whale Accumulation: Smart Money Positioning Early

Whales are among the most closely watched participants in crypto markets because their actions often precede major trends. Large holders typically accumulate during periods of low volatility and muted sentiment, when prices can be absorbed without attracting attention. Recent on-chain patterns suggest that XRP whales have been steadily increasing their positions, a behavior that aligns with early-stage positioning rather than late-cycle chasing.

This accumulation matters because it reduces available supply on exchanges. When fewer tokens are readily available for trading, even modest increases in demand can have an outsized impact on price. Over time, this supply tightening can create the kind of imbalance that fuels sharp rallies. For those tracking the XRP new ATH narrative, whale behavior is one of the strongest supporting signals.

Equally important is the patience whales demonstrate. They are less likely to react to short-term volatility and more likely to hold through consolidations. This stabilizing effect can dampen downside risk while increasing the probability of a sustained breakout once momentum returns. When whales accumulate quietly and hold firmly, markets often underestimate how much pressure is building beneath the surface.

On-Chain Activity: What the Data Says About Network Health

Price tells one story, but on-chain data tells another. Healthy networks often show growth in transaction volume, active addresses, and consistent usage. XRP’s ledger activity has demonstrated resilience during market downturns, suggesting that its utility-driven transactions continue regardless of speculative cycles. This consistency is a critical factor when evaluating long-term potential.

An increase in on-chain activity often precedes price appreciation because it reflects genuine usage rather than pure speculation. When demand for network services grows, it creates organic reasons for holding and transacting the token. Over time, this usage-based demand can support higher valuations and make the case for an XRP new ATH more compelling.

Additionally, on-chain transparency allows analysts to observe accumulation patterns, exchange flows, and holder behavior. Reduced exchange inflows, for example, often indicate that holders are less interested in selling. When combined with rising activity, this suggests confidence in future price appreciation rather than fear of decline.

Market Structure and Technical Setup

From a technical perspective, XRP has spent extended periods consolidating within defined ranges. While this can be frustrating for traders seeking quick returns, long consolidations often precede strong directional moves. The longer price compresses, the more energy builds for an eventual breakout.

Key resistance levels act as psychological barriers. Once breached, they often trigger momentum-based buying and short covering, accelerating the move. If XRP can establish higher lows and reclaim major resistance zones, the path toward an XRP new ATH becomes clearer from a market structure standpoint.

Volume behavior is also crucial. Sustainable breakouts are usually accompanied by rising volume, signaling genuine participation rather than thin liquidity spikes. Traders watching for confirmation often wait for this combination of price and volume before committing, which can further fuel upside once the breakout is validated.
